It was recorded and made worldwide in 2023 and has started making a tremendous trend in the United States. “Mercy / Tremble” is said to be one of the tracks off their new project “How To Start A Housefire (Pt. 2)”.
Housefires released their studio album “How To Start A Housefire (Pt. 2)” after the booming release of “How To Start A Housefire Pt. 1 (2013)”. The new project was released through HOUSEFIRES MUSIC, a subsidiary of Tribl Records, under exclusive license to Capitol CMG, Inc.

How To Start A Housefire (Pt. 2) is a splendid and phenomenal body of work that is made of contemporary gospel ballads. It compiles a number of fourteen tracks that feature guest appearances from; Nate Moore, Davy Flowers, Ahjah Walls, Ryan Ellis, Mariah Adigun, Cecily Hennigan, D.O.E, Mariah Adigun, Harvest Grapevine, WLKRS Worship and Blake Wiggins, whose impressive service is well-acknowledged.
